    I actually like Hart more than Ullmark.
    I know Hart had a disastrous season... but it was so disastrous it's hard to believe it will repeat.
    Goalie coaches even found distinguishable flaws in his game not consistent with his past play.

    I think PHI retooling half their defensive group, especially adding Ryan Ellis, is going to make last year be an outlier among Hart's stats.
    (Nolan Patrick and Phillipe Myers, who wasn't clicking with Sanheim - are not big defensive losses for PHI... those subtractions in of themselves might be helpful)

    I do like Ullmark... and Boston...
    This IS a close value comparison for me.
    But PHI is clearly on the rise with its younger group of players... and Hart has no threat behind him.
    Ullmark has Swayman right there... and I think Swayman will be the real deal and steal the G1 gig as soon as a month or two in.
    Also - everybody assumes Patrice Bergeron is back and re-signs after his contract expires.
    But what if he is a Barry Sanders type guy and says "That's it. I've had enough. It was a good ride. I'm retiring".
    Boston already is without a bonafide C2. Imagine them without a bonafide C1 and C2... not good for the BOS goalies.

    So... for me, I like Hart.
